iFi Audio iUSB Power: Marvelous new upgrade for USB-powered DACs says George of Computeraudiophile!

 

“the bottom line is that the original power source is the computer, or perhaps a powered USB hub; not the most prepossessing of power sources….The USB output of my laptop (which I use as a music server) fed into the input of the iUSB, and the DragonFly plugged into the “Music + Power” USB “A” output of the iUSB power supply. From then -on everything else was as before…I couldn’t believe the difference! The DragonFly v.1.2 was noticeably quieter – especially through ‘phones. But through speakers, the soundstage opened-up, image specificity became more precise, the bass tightened-up noticeably, and the top end became even smoother, and more open, with more “air” around the instruments. This is a dynamite upgrade to already great sounding DAC. I recommend that you try to hear it for yourself!”

HDPhonic tries the iDSD Nano at Munich!

 

“At the iFi Audio booth there was only one new product: the Nano-iDSD, the smallest portable DA converter in the world that supports PCM up to 384 kHz and DSD up to 6.2 MHz with dual BB1795 chip developed exclusively by Burr-Brown Japan. The peculiarity of this DAC is the direct conversion of native DSD directly to analog without intermediate steps. We got to hear this DAC with both a LCD-2 and with our HD 600 thanks to the kindness and courtesy of Vincent Luke, marketing coordinator of iFi Audio. Our first impressions of the DAC using DSD files of records that we know quite well, were extremely positive as regards the overall sonic performance. The sound was spacious, clean and warm at the same time and very close to that of a studio master tape played back from a one-inch recorder. iFi Audio has put a product on the market that will be talked about not just because of its price of $ 189.”
